Click Light Pack Font Review

As a web designer, I’m always on the lookout for fonts that bring both personality and clarity to a site. Click Light Pack by Etewut has quickly become one of my go-to choices for digital projects that need a touch of modern charm without sacrificing readability.

First Impressions: A Font That Feels Right at Home

Testing Click Light Pack in a hero section of a boutique online store was the perfect starting point. The font’s clean lines and subtle curves give it a fresh, approachable feel. It feels like a modern sans serif with just enough character to stand out without being overwhelming.

I used it for a headline over a product image banner, and it worked beautifully. The light weight made the text feel airy and uncluttered, which is exactly what I wanted for a minimalist brand aesthetic.

Web Usability: Responsive and Readable

One of the biggest concerns when using a decorative or display font is how it performs on smaller screens. Click Light Pack holds up well on mobile devices, maintaining its legibility even at smaller sizes. I tested it on buttons, headers, and call-to-action areas, and it never felt too thin or hard to read.

On dark backgrounds, the font still pops without needing extra contrast adjustments. On light backgrounds, it blends nicely into the design while still drawing attention where needed.

Design Applications: From Headers to Branding

Click Light Pack excels as a display font for headings, logos, and section titles. It adds visual interest without distracting from the content. I used it in a portfolio website header, and it gave the page a cohesive, professional look that matched the creative vibe of the site.

For a coaching website, I paired it with a simple sans serif for body copy. The contrast worked well—Click Light Pack added a modern flair to the headlines, while the clean font kept the rest of the text easy to scan.

It also shines in digital ads and promotional landing pages. The font’s balance of style and clarity makes it ideal for CTA buttons and short, impactful phrases.

Limitations: When Not to Use Click Light Pack

While Click Light Pack is great for display purposes, it’s not the best choice for long paragraphs of body text. Its light weight and subtle details can make extended reading less comfortable, especially on small screens or in dense layouts.

It also isn’t suitable for navigation menus, form labels, or accessibility-heavy interfaces. In those cases, a more robust sans serif or serif font would be a better fit.

Font Pairing: Finding the Right Balance

Pairing Click Light Pack with a clean, neutral font helps it shine without competing. For example, pairing it with a simple sans serif like Open Sans or Lato creates a nice contrast that enhances both fonts’ strengths.

For a more editorial feel, I’ve paired it with a soft serif font. This combination works well for blog headers or magazine-style websites where a bit of elegance is desired.

When designing a digital brand kit, I used Click Light Pack for logo text and social media graphics, while relying on a bolder sans serif for captions and descriptions. The result was a balanced, cohesive look that felt both modern and professional.
